Dubai, Hospitality Innovation Summit 2024

The Hospitality Innovation Summit (HIS) Saudi Arabia & UAE by GBB Venture returns for its 2nd Edition on March 6th and 7th 2024. Following a widely successful first run, the two-day event at Hilton Al Habtoor City, Dubai, anticipates another extravaganza of hospitality industry expertise

The 2nd edition of the Hospitality Innovation Summit: Powering the Region’s Hospitality Sector through Innovation and Collaboration. With a focus on Innovation, Integration, and Implementation, the event will bring together industry decision-makers, innovative suppliers, and eminent speakers. It will include insightful presentations, a special interview series, and pre-scheduled B2B meetings. The summit will also host a debate among representatives of both homegrown and international brands, promising an amalgamation of knowledge-expanding insights and networking opportunities unlike any other.

Operating under the theme “Innovation, Integration, and Implementation”, the summit brings together a wealth of industry leaders. Over 200 decision-making delegates, 70 innovative suppliers, and 30 notable speakers are expected to attend, providing the platform for a broad mix of owners, developers, architects, designers, and suppliers.

As the Knowledge Partner, Knight Frank launches the summit calling on their insight into the Saudi and UAE hotel markets with Turab Saleem inaugurating the proceedings. Following this, attendees will hear from luminaries such as Justin Wells and Richard Nelson, rounding off with Maya Ziadeh moderating an engaging interview series.

One of the highlights of HIS is the provision for streamlined B2B meetings. Establishing direct lines of communication between pre-qualified buyers and suppliers, it’s expected to bring serious business networks into play. This includes keynote presentations from international architects and designers from LAVA, CHAP, Woodsbagot, WATG, and more.

The summit will host a debate featuring domestic and global brands’ representatives, including Hakan Ozkasikci of Kerzner International, Gilbert Khalil of Sunset Hospitality Group, and Maliha Nishat from Marriott International.

Finally, the summit will play host to an impressive rostrum of industry leads such as ISHRAQ Hospitality CEO, and the Design Director of Taiba Investments, creating an exclusive, high-quality environment.
